Flat roof sealing services involve applying specialized coatings or sealants to the surface of flat or low-slope roofs. This process helps create a waterproof barrier that prevents water from seeping through the roofing material. Contractors typically start by inspecting the existing roof to identify any areas of damage, cracks, or wear. Once the surface is prepared, they apply the sealant evenly across the roof, ensuring all vulnerable spots are covered. Proper sealing not only enhances the roof’s durability but also extends its lifespan, reducing the likelihood of leaks and the need for costly repairs down the line.

Many common problems can be addressed through flat roof sealing. Over time, flat roofs are prone to developing cracks, blisters, or punctures due to exposure to weather elements such as rain, snow, and temperature fluctuations. These issues can lead to leaks that threaten the interior of a property, causing water damage and mold growth. Sealing helps to fill in small cracks and gaps, preventing water infiltration. It also protects against the deterioration caused by UV rays and moisture, which can weaken roofing materials and lead to more extensive repairs if left unaddressed.

Flat roof sealing is frequently used on commercial properties, but many residential homes with flat or low-slope roofs also benefit from this service. Apartment buildings, retail stores, warehouses, and office complexes often have flat roofs that require regular maintenance to keep them watertight. Residential properties with modern architectural designs may feature flat roofs or roof terraces that also need sealing to prevent leaks and water damage. Homeowners who notice water stains on ceilings, pooling water after rain, or are planning a roof upgrade may find flat roof sealing to be an effective solution to improve the integrity of their roof.

The overview below groups typical Flat Roof Sealing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Waterford, CT.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or sealing jobs on flat roofs in Waterford range from $250 to $600. Many routine repairs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age and materials used.

Medium Projects - Larger sealing projects, such as re-sealing an entire flat roof section, generally cost between $600 and $1,500. These jobs are common for property owners seeking to extend roof lifespan without full replacement.

Full Roof Sealing - Complete sealing of a flat roof can range from $1,500 to $3,500, with larger or more complex roofs pushing beyond this range. Many local contractors handle projects in this tier, especially for commercial buildings.

Full Roof Replacement - When sealing is part of a full roof replacement, costs can reach $5,000 or more, depending on roof size and complexity. Such projects are less frequent but necessary for heavily damaged or aging roofs in the area.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is flat roof sealing? Flat roof sealing involves applying a protective coating or membrane to prevent water leaks and improve the roof's durability.

Why should I consider sealing my flat roof? Sealing can help prevent water infiltration, extend the roof's lifespan, and reduce the risk of costly repairs.

How do local contractors approach flat roof sealing? They typically assess the roof’s condition, clean the surface, and then apply suitable sealing materials tailored to the roof type.

What types of materials are used for flat roof sealing? Common options include liquid membranes, asphalt-based coatings, and rubberized sealants, depending on the roof's needs.

Is flat roof sealing a maintenance requirement? Regular sealing can be part of ongoing roof maintenance to help protect against weather-related damage and prolong roof performance.
